Abstract
Every well-informed American philosopher is aware that the Archives de Philosophie is the best French journal of philosophy, and perhaps even the foremost philosophical journal of Continental Europe. When one considers this special, four hundred page issue devoted entirely to Hegel on the occasion of the 200th anniversary of his birth, the superiority of this journal is quite evident and can be easily appreciated. The very length of this special issue and the richness of the various articles make it impossible to give a detailed account of each contribution. This being the case, we should like to give the reader an idea of the entire work and submit to his judgment some appreciations.
